🔧 DIY Tips

Want to access high storage yourself? Here's how to stay safe:

🔧 Essential equipment

  • Proper stepladder or ladder (not a chair)
  • Someone to hold the ladder steady
  • Clear floor space for retrieved items
  • Good lighting to see what you're reaching for

📐 Safe ladder use

  1. Check ladder is in good condition (no cracks, loose rungs)
  2. Set it at correct angle - base 1 meter out for every 4 meters up
  3. Three points of contact at all times (two feet, one hand)
  4. Never stand on top two rungs
  5. Get someone to foot the ladder (hold it steady)

✂️ Retrieving items safely

  • Don't carry heavy items while climbing - pass them to someone
  • Don't overreach - move the ladder instead
  • Bring items to edge of shelf before lifting
  • Lower heavy items, don't drop them
  • Take multiple trips rather than carrying too much

⚠️ Common DIY mistakes

  • Standing on chairs, kitchen stools, or furniture
  • Overreaching instead of repositioning ladder
  • Trying to carry items while climbing
  • Using damaged or unsuitable ladders
  • Working alone with no one to help

💡 Pro trick: For loft access, use a head torch to keep both hands free for the ladder. Also, slide heavy boxes to the edge of the loft hatch first, then lower them down with rope or a helper - never try to carry heavy things down a loft ladder.
